Sandwell has an estimated population of 327,000 people. The majority of the population falls within the 20-39 age range. The community has 153,400 economically active people, representing 74.7% of the population, with an unemployment rate of 5.3%. This rate is slightly higher than the country's 4% national average. The average gross salary in the United Kingdom is close to £31,000. Residents of Sandwell earn £23,823 a year on average.

Three examples of available franchise business possibilities
If you are interested in opening a business in the Restaurant sector, Caprinos Pizza could be an option for you. This brand is growing, counting 16 outlets in the UK. Starting a Caprinos Pizza business requires an initial investment of £65,000. At least £50,000 should come from your own personal investment. The higher startup costs make this an opportunity best suited for most established franchisees with greater access to financial resources.
Another option to consider is Veeno. By joining its network of eight franchisees, you could play a part in this brand's success. This business requires an initial investment of £80,000. If you plan on getting a loan to cover startup costs, you should anticipate adding a personal investment of 30 to 50% of the total investment as a general rule. The minimal personal investment to start a Veeno business is £35,000. Due to the higher startup costs, this option is not recommended for first-time franchisees. A large premises will also be required to operate this business. Also, if you can't afford the startup costs alone, you may be entitled to financial aid.
